CVE-2007-1730
Published: Mar 28, 2007
Modified: Aug 7, 2024
PUBLISHED
Description
Integer signedness error in the DCCP support in the do_dccp_getsockopt function in net/dccp/proto.c in Linux kernel 2.6.20 and later allows local users to read kernel memory or cause a denial of service (oops) via a negative optlen value.
